Sister Jones presented from the life of Ezra Taft Benson lesson # 4 called "Living Joyfully in Troubled Times" President Benson states that with faith in our Heavenly Father, we can have hope for the future, optimism in our present tasks, and inner peace. Our happiness must be earned from day to day, but it is worth the effort and because our Heavenly Father wants us to be happy, He will bless us as we follow His will for us.

When asked what activities help lift the sisters spirits when they are discouraged, listening to music, attending the temple, and reading the scriptures were among the comments made.  In addition to these activities it was mentioned that when we are in the service of our fellowmen we feel a kinship to our Savior and draw closer to our Father in Heaven.
